FAQ
NuForum
用户名
Email
自动登录
找回密码
密码
登录
立即注册
只需一步,快速开始
登录
注册
搜索
搜索
搜索
热搜
NANO
NUC
MINI51F
M051
开发板
研讨会
视频
本版
帖子
用户
本版
帖子
用户
道具
勋章
任务
留言板
群组
设置
我的收藏
退出
牛卧堂MCU技术交流
»
首页
›
MCU/MPU经验讨论
›
新唐Cortex-M0 MCU技术交流
›
關於GPIO輸出控制的宏
返回列表
[NUC]
關於GPIO輸出控制的宏
[复制链接]
adolclistin
发表于 2019-4-13 17:51:32
|
显示全部楼层
|
阅读模式
各位前辈 贵安
我这几天买了M487开发板学习使用。
在GPIO的部分,设定GPIO PA 第5脚位为输出可以使用下面的程式。GPIO_SetMode(PA, BIT5, GPIO_MODE_OUTPUT);如果 PA 第5脚位要设定为High,则PA5 = 1;反之设定为LowPA5 = 0 ;
我的问题:是否可以使用较完整的路径来控制脚位的输出。例如说:GPIO_SET(PA, BIT5);或是GPIO_RESET(PA, BIT5);先谢谢大家。
post_newreply
回复
使用道具
举报
liushiming82
发表于 2019-4-15 15:33:09
|
显示全部楼层
应该有位操作的宏的 ,你在GPIO的文件中找一找
回复
支持
反对
使用道具
举报
jamesliu
发表于 2019-4-15 16:30:32
|
显示全部楼层
本帖最后由 jamesliu 于 2019-4-15 16:31 编辑
新唐的MCU的GPIO是可以直接操作的,不需要通过函数来操作PA5的输出。C语言中写PA5 = 1;或PA5 = 0;就可以了
回复
支持
反对
使用道具
举报
nes6502
发表于 2019-5-5 09:54:20
|
显示全部楼层
自己实现一个, 新唐未提供你说的方式的库函数,
回复
支持
反对
使用道具
举报
返回列表
高级模式
B
Color
Image
Link
Quote
Code
Smilies
|
上传
点击附件文件名添加到帖子内容中
描述
阅读权限
本版积分规则
发表回复
回帖后跳转到最后一页
热心会员
经常帮助其他会员答疑
最佳新人
注册账号后积极发帖的会员
新唐MCU